Ionic bonding

A

Electrostatic attraction between positive and negative ions

Properties of ionic substances

A

High melting and boiling point
Dont conduct electricity when solid
Conducts electricity in liquid or molten

Properties of simple molecular covalent substances

A

Don’t conduct electricity
Small molecules
weak intermolecular forces
Low melting and boiling points

Giant covalent substances

A

High melting/boiling points
Diamond, graphite, silicon dioxide
Mostly doesn’t conduct electricity

Metallic bonding

A

Forces of attraction between delocalised electrons and nuclei of metal ions

Properties of metals

A

High melting/ boiling points
Good conductors of heat + electricity
Malleable and soft
